Postmortem timeline — Glimmerfall canary gating. 14:02: canary promoted despite error-rate gate firing; gate was marked advisory after last week's rule refactor. 14:09: full rollout began. 14:17: rollback triggered manually. Root issue: gating rules lost their blocking flag during migration. Action: restore blocking semantics, add a config lint. Release manager, the failing canary's build token is below for cross-reference.

build token for yajof-bajof: htk31_506ff1188f74596b5bb2eec94edc43c

Welcome to Torvale Systems. During your first month you may accompany a senior engineer to our cage at the Ridgemoor colocation facility. Always sign the facility log, wear your lanyard visibly, and never prop the cage door. Photograph nothing inside Hall C. For your visit, you will need the following door-pass code.

turnstile pass: bdg-QZV-3

Welcome! Before you review anything touching Glimmercache, here's the gist: it's the tile-rendering cache layer sitting between the Mapwright renderer and the edge nodes. Tiles are keyed by zoom, region, and style hash — mess up the hash and you'll serve stale art to half of production. Watch for eviction-policy changes especially; they're deceptively easy to get wrong. The team keeps invariants, gotchas, and past review notes all in one place, which you can find here.

wiki page, tahaf-tajog: https://jira.ordindyn.corp/pipeline

### Action Item: Spoolhaven Retry Storm

From last Tuesday's outage: the Spoolhaven print service retried failed jobs without backoff, saturating the render pool. Fix merged; retries now use capped exponential backoff with jitter. Owner will monitor for a week before closing. The agreed retry constants are recorded below.

constants for yadup-kajof:
RATE_LIMITS = {
    "zorwyn": 1,
    "druwyn": 1,
}